.The storied "L A BAR" is a classic SW LA small-town drinkery; locals, boaters, wildife folks, & tourists flock in.N.B.: When last I visited, smoking was allowed inside; a giant negative for us. Sorry.Other than the smoke; a great little place with much history.Cajun musician Doug Kershaw got his start shining shoes out front on the sidewalk.Street parking, or just walk over from Bank Hotel or the nice treed lakefront park nearby.If you can stand the SMOKE, do visit.Rick.

This is an old, classic. This bar has been in Lake Arthur since 1933. It hass survived Hurricane Audrey, Rita, Laura and Delta. The surrounding area is beautiful and peaceful.

This is a historic Local Bar in Lake Arthur LA. Has a new owner who has to maintain it as a Historic Site. Although local, everyone is welcome and all are friendly.
